        Re: Projects anyone?

        "placid" <Bulkan@gmail.c omwrites:
        I'm looking for anyone who is working on a project at the moment that
        needs help (volunteer).
        The Volunteer Opportunities page is a bit thin at the moment. I'd hope
        people can respond to this thread and update that page with other
        projects that need help.

        <URL:http://wiki.python.org/moin/VolunteerOpport unities>

        The Coding Project Ideas page is more specifically focussed on getting
        programmer help.

        <URL:http://wiki.python.org/moin/CodingProjectId eas>

        Browse the Cheese Shop for packages that you'd like to improve, and
        offer your help to the project maintainer.

        <URL:http://cheeseshop.pyth on.org/pypi/>
